CBSE 10th 12th Board Exam 2026 Date Sheet Revised, Board Releases Important Circular

Central Board of Secondary Education, CBSE 10th 12th Board Exam 2026 date sheet has been revised. The board has released an important circular, sharing the change in the date sheet. The Class 10, 12 board exam scheduled for March 3, 2026 has been rescheduled.

As per the notice, now available on cbse.gov.in, CBSE 10th and 12th board exam scheduled for March 3, 2026 have been rescheduled. The exam will now be conducted on March 11, 2026 for Class 10 and April 10, 2026 for Class 12. The revised date sheet – subject exams that will be shifted are listed below.

CBSE 10th 12th Board Exam Revised Date sheet

Subjects Earlier Schedule Revised Date
Class 10 Tibetan, German, National Cadet Corps, Bhoti, Bodo, Tangkhul, Japanese, Bhutia, Spanish, Kashmiri, Mizo, Bahasa Melayu and Elements ofBook Keeping & Accountancy March 3, 2026 March 11, 2026
Class 12 Legal Studies March 3, 2026 April 10, 2026

 

Students, parents may note that the dates have not been inserted into the earlier schedule but added at the end of the earlier schedule. The exams for CBSE Class 10 were earlier ending on March 10 and now will end on March 11.

Simillarly, CBSE 12th Board Exams 2026 will now end on April 10 instead of the earlier schedule of April 9, 2026.

The date sheet has been revised due to administrative reasons. The board has further clarified that there are no other changes in the date sheet. The other contents of CBSE 10th 12th Date Sheet 2026 released on October 30, 2025 remains the same. Revised dates will also reflect in CBSE admit cards, when released.
